SIS STRIKES RACING DEAL WITH SPANISH & LATIN AMERICAN OPERATOR RETABET

Multi-channel live betting services supplier SIS (Sports Information Services) has partnered with Spanish and Latin American operator Ekasa Reta. 

The deal will see SIS deliver its 24/7 Live Betting Channels to Ekasa Reta’s RETAbet brand. Content will include a mix of leading horse and greyhound racing from around the world, with a betting event taking place every 3 minutes. 

Content will be supplied to RETAbet’s online sportsbook in Spain (www.retabet.es), and online and retail outlets in Peru and other Latin American countries (www.retabet.pe). SIS’s service will provide Ekasa Reta with streamed pictures, commentary, data, on-screen graphics, betting prompts, and an extensive range of markets and prices. 

Exclusive live horse racing from the UK and Ireland will be included, along with international racing from Dubai, Latin America, South Korea, and the United States, plus UK and Irish greyhound racing.
